Cascade Management, Inc. is a property management and consulting firm in the Pacific Northwest that handles rental real estate. It manages a wide portfolio including over 11,000 multifamily housing units and more than 500,000 square feet of commercial space across Oregon and Washington, offering services to property owners and tenants. Its products work by combining all parts of property management into an integrated team—covering day-to-day operations, financial oversight, asset management, and advisory consulting—primed to run buildings smoothly and efficiently in exchange for management fees and consulting revenue. The company distinguishes itself through a long history (since 1974), a large, diverse portfolio, and a focus on client satisfaction and operational efficiency to deliver reliable, measurable performance. The goal is to provide dependable, high-quality management and advisory services that maximize value for property owners and tenants in the Pacific Northwest.

Simplify's Take

What believers are saying

  • Portfolio expanded from 9 to 150+ properties, signaling strong growth.
  • Established 52-year track record builds client trust and retention.
  • Multifamily and commercial diversification reduces single-asset-class dependency risk.

What critics are saying

  • Oregon rent caps at 7% plus inflation directly limit revenue growth.
  • Institutional investors internalizing management displace third-party managers from accounts.
  • Geographic concentration in Oregon and Washington exposes to regional downturns.
